Weekly Financial Review

Why?

Looking at your bills each week, no matter how bad the damage, is a healthy habit to get into. You can learn so much about your spending patterns and what expenses can be cut out simply by reviewing your bank statements. But, if you're anything like me, you probably avoid doing this because you don't want to feel guilty about how much you spent - which is the wrong attitude! In 2018, it's time to lose the attitude of shame and gain an attitude of self-improvement, amirite?

How I'm Going to Do It:

  • Make it part of my Sunday self-care ritual.
  • Sit down with a hot tea (or wine....), some Netflix and my bank statements.
  • Highlight expenses that can be cut.

Studying Ahead of Time

Why?

In 2017, I became obsessed with my studyblr (check me out at haleymariestudies!). Not only are studyblrs gorgeous places for study inspo, but they're also incredibly helpful resources that have taught me a lot about the right way to study. I've learned that it's important to start studying as soon as you get the material so you're not overwhelmed when exam time rolls around - which is exactly what I plan to do in 2018.

How I'm Going to Do It:

  • Stock up on adorable stationary at sites like Mochithings and Amazon.
  • Make a habit of re-writing my notes and/or making flashcards right after class.
  • Set aside an hour before bed every night to review the most difficult concepts.
